1895 Richmond Spiders football team

1895 Richmond Spiders football team

American college football season


The 1895 Richmond Colts football team was an American football team that represented Richmond College—now known as the University of Richmond—as an independent during the 1895 college football season. Led by Dana Rucker in his fourth and final season as head coach, Richmond compiled a record of 0–5–1. For the second straight season, the team was winless.[1]
